Meaning of Principal Business

What is the meaning of "Principal Business" of a Company in terms of Companies Act, 1956.

Kindly provide a reference from where the meaning can be derived or the term has been defined.

The term Principal business is not defined in law, according to context since the matter pertains to Companies Act, it is construed as the main objects of the company which is declared in the MOA while registering the company.

See, Principal Business is the busienss for which a company is formed. There might b other businesses which would b necessary for carrying on the principal business. 

For Ex: A Construction Company having as its main business the construction related works can also carry out some other businesses which would help it carry out the principal business of Construction.
